N Korea shows Kim with cane in first sighting in weeks

Published Tue, Oct 14, 2014 · 09:50 PM

Seoul

NORTH Korean leader Kim Jong Un made his first public appearance in six weeks, walking with a cane during a visit to a new residential block as he ended a period of seclusion that prompted speculation about his grip on power.

Mr Kim commended workers who built the Wisong Scientists Residential District and was accompanied by senior officials including Vice-Marshal Hwang Pyong So and Workers' Party secretary Choe Ryong Hae, the official Korean Central News Agency reported on Tuesday.
